The scene in West Mersea, Essex, after a teenage girl and a woman in her 40s have died after a group got into difficulty in the water at the beach of a holiday parkA seven-year-old boy remains in critical condition following an incident at West Mersea Beach which left his teenage cousin and her mother dead, police have said.
All family members subsequently made “significant efforts to help each other”, Essex Police said on Tuesday.
Sameeha and Shelina Rahman, from the Ilford area in east London, died, while Musa was flown to hospital where he remains in a critical condition.
A number of family members were also taken to hospital as a result of the incident and are recovering, the force added.
